<<Justice Chandra Dhari Singh [of the Delhi High Court] observed that if
something is said with a smile, then there is no criminality but if
something is said offensively, then there may be criminality. The court was
hearing CPI(M) leader Brinda Karat’s petition against a lower court order
in which the prayer for registration of FIR against Union Minister Anurag
Thakur and MP Parvesh Verma for their alleged hate speech was declined.>>
